Astera Data Pipeline Builder is a no-code solution for designing and automating data pipelines. It allows users to read and write data across various file formats, databases, and applications. Users can execute ETL and ELT pipelines manually, schedule automated reruns, or integrate them into broader data management processes.

Adverity is particularly useful if there is a large range of data sets that you want to combine to get an 'overall' view. Previously we had used Google Analytics, but found that this was too useful for our big client accounts that we were working on. So I think that if there is an individual who is responsible for analytics or data, and also a paid media team then this is a tool which is essential. For companies that have limited activity then I think this tool could potentially over-complicate for less reward.
I have only been using Astera Centerprise for about 6 months and I am still learning the ins and out of it. A scenario where it seems to do well is in generating reports from SQL queries that we already had and no longer have to run the reports manually. The SQL Query Source object has been the most useful tool for me thus far. I have yet to fully stress test the server side of Astera Centerprise, but currently there have been some version updates that required me to re-set up all the scheduled jobs that we have. We only have 8 jobs thus far but have plans to expand this into the hundreds and those same updates would require exponential amounts of work.

When purchasing Astera Centerprise you are given options on how you would like to be trained and each option comes with a different price tag. We chose to be trained using online meetings over several days. The training went too fast and it was not always easy to understand until I started using the product.
I am a person that wants to learn how and why something works so that I can use the knowledge in the future. When contacting the support team they take the problem, create a solution for you and send it back. The solutions always work, but when I get the solution I have to review every field and function to understand how it works so that I can re-create it for another solution I need. I would much rather have the support team explain what I had done incorrectly and what they changed or I would like to find a solution with them instead of having it handed to me.
Astera uses license keys to allow their customers rights to only the functionality that was purchased. Each user and server has its own key and each key is only good for one year. There have been 2 different times that we received keys that had less functionality that we purchased. It wasn't until it created problems that we noticed and had to request new keys. This year our sales representative made sure she was available when we updated our keys so that if there was a problem she could fix it right away; however, there were not issues this year. I believe this is something they pay closer attention to now.

We looked at continuing to use SSIS as an alternative. Although we own SSIS as part of our SQL licensing, we found that it takes a much higher skill level to create solutions. It also does not have the ability to parse unstructured data the way that Centerprise Data Integrator can. We also looked at Datawatch Monarch as a possibility but found it over-all to be cost-prohibitive. We also looked at a cheaper alternative called SimX but did not have a strong confidence in the product as we evaluated it. We landed on Centerprise Data Integrator as it met all of our business requirements and we know we could leverage it for many uses across our enterprise.
